What is a Mental Health Assessment?
A mental health assessment is a casual conversation between you and a mental health professional in order to determine the kind of support you require. The mental health professional will take a holistic approach to assess your needs and will take into consideration your lifestyle, cultural background, beliefs and how these can affect your mood and emotional state. You will need to be honest and forthcoming with the mental health professional during the evaluation so that they can understand your situation better. They will inquire about your past, current symptoms and how long they've been present for. They will also assess your ability to perform socially and manage your emotions. They might utilize music, art pictures or play therapy, drama or electronic assessment tools to help you express your feelings. They can also take formal tests to determine conditions like depression, anxiety or PTSD.
The mental health evaluation includes a physical exam and a psychological evaluation. During the physical exam the doctor will observe your general appearance and behavior Paramedic Mental health Assessment as well as your concentration and alertness. They will also ask you about your family medical history and any medications that you may be taking. If they suspect that you might be suffering from a neurological disorder and they are likely to conduct lab tests, such as urine tests and blood tests. They may also order MRIs or CT scans.
During the psychological assessment, your doctor will gather details about your personality and feelings by conducting an interview in a structured or unstructured method. They will ask about your symptoms and how they impact your daily life. They will also ask if your symptoms have improved or got worse, and what makes them worse. They will ask you about your childhood and family, your relationships, your work and any major events that may have influenced your symptoms.

What happens during an assessment of mental health?
The person who is conducting the assessment, like a psychiatrist, psychiatric nursing will ask you questions regarding your employee mental health assessment health issues and how they are affecting you. They will also conduct an examination of you and take notes. Remember that this process was designed to assist you.
Your medical history and family history will be reviewed. They will also look at any traumatizing events that you've experienced in your life as they could be linked to your mental health symptoms.
You will be asked questions about your mental health, how you manage it, and how the symptoms affect you at work, at home, and in social settings. They might ask you questions about your relationships or the stressors in your life. They will also be interested in any medication that you are taking, whether prescription or available over the counter. They may also want to know about any other health conditions you suffer from, like thyroid problems or a physical injury.
A doctor or psychiatrist will perform a basic physical exam as part the evaluation to ensure that your symptoms are not caused by something else. They may also be required to conduct laboratory tests, such as blood and urine tests. If a doctor suspects that you may have a neurological issue, they may also order a CT scan or an MRI.
It is essential to be honest with professionals performing the evaluation in order to get the entire picture to diagnose you. They may be able help you determine a plan of treatment that will work for you.

What is the purpose for a accurate mental health assessment health evaluation?
It's normal to feel down and anxious at times. But if these symptoms persist and disrupt your daily life You should seek the advice of an expert. A mental health evaluation is when a psychologist or doctor examines the symptoms of mental illness.
Doctors can test patients for common mental disorders by asking them simple questions and utilizing screening questionnaires like the Kessler Psychological Distress Scale, Patient Stress Questionnaire or My Mood Monitor checklist. If they notice any signs types of mental health assessments a more serious problem, they will send the patient to an expert in their area for further tests and an assessment.
The mental health assessment typically involves a series questions about the impact of the symptoms on an individual's ability to think and remember, as well as interact with others. They will also ask about how long the symptoms have been recurring and if they have a relatives with a history of mental illness. They will also inquire about alcohol or drug abuse and if symptoms have changed.
A mental or medical professional will also perform an examination of the body and will order any lab tests necessary to rule out medical causes for the problem. They will also listen to what the individual has to say and assess how they interact with other people and how they behave in everyday situations.
In a mental health assessment, a psychiatrist or psychologist will interview the person about their symptoms, Paramedic Mental health Assessment how they affect their life and what they have attempted to do to cope with them. They will also ask about their experiences with depression, anxiety or other mental illnesses, and about any medications they are taking.

How do I get an assessment of my mental health?
Just like you go to the doctor for a routine exam, if you're having concerns about your mental health, talk to your family doctor or a psychologist. They will recommend you to a specialist or you can make the appointment yourself. You can also get an assessment of your mental health by making contact with your local NHS trust and asking for a referral.
Most psychiatric evaluations begin with a medical assessment. During the interview the doctor will inquire about your symptoms and the length of time they have been present. They will also ask about your family history as well as any other relevant information.
The interview will be conducted either in person or over the phone. The specialist will make notes while they listen to your story. They will then evaluate your needs and offer suggestions regarding treatment. This will help them determine the mental health services such as outpatient or inpatient, would best suit your needs.
Certain psychiatric assessments may involve physical examination. This is because some physical ailments, such as neurological disorders or thyroid disorders may cause symptoms that are similar to mental illness. A physical exam may aid the psychiatrist in determining if you are taking any medications. This includes over-the-counter and natural supplements.
